The van, a Mercedes Sprinter, was stolen from Lørenskog station. This weekend, the police went to search the premises after learning that the car contained a container containing cyanide, a highly toxic substance.

On Monday morning, police said the car was still missing. There is no suspect either.

The case is still being investigated as a serious robbery and the police do not exclude the unloading of the cargo.

"If someone discovers suspicious objects, we ask that the police be notified immediately and that the utmost caution be displayed," writes the East Police District in a statement.

The police are still asking for advice on this. If someone sees the car, he asks to be contacted by the emergency number 112.

The police direction, Kripos, PST, the customs administration and the health authorities are notified.

The East Police District has put in place great exploration resources to find the car. The car belongs to a courier company in Romerike and the owner is questioned.

The owner did not want to comment on the case before NRK, but told Dagbladet this weekend that cyanide was always packaged in a plastic pallet and that the container was unlocked.

"I have no reason to believe that it is nothing other than an ordinary car theft," he said.

We still do not know where the cargo was or why the van was left in the parking lot.

The director of pharmaceutical procurement for all Norwegian health companies, Bente Hayes, told NRK on Sunday that the shipping and storage rules were probably broken.

The shipment of pharmaceuticals was probably sourced from a Swedish supplier and was intended for several Norwegian hospitals.

The plastic container containing cyanide is small, white and has a red lid, according to the police. It is not certain that it is marked.

Cyanide is an extremely toxic substance found in the form of gas, liquid and powder. It can be fatal and can be used to develop an even more dangerous substance, hydrocyanic acid.

The stolen car was a Mercedes Sprinter 2018 model bearing the CV 88344 registration number. It is silver in color and does not carry any particular marking.
